About this property
Royal Hotel
Royal Hotel is a great choice for a stay in Chilliwack. Guests looking for a bite to eat can visit Tokyo Japanese Grill, which serves Japanese cuisine and is open for lunch and dinner. Fellow travellers say great things about the helpful staff.

Frequently asked questions
Does Royal Hotel offer free cancellation for a full refund?
Yes, Royal Hotel does have fully refundable room rates available to book on our site. If you’ve booked a fully refundable room rate, this can be cancelled up to a few days before check-in, depending on the property's cancellation policy. Just make sure that you check this property's cancellation policy for the exact terms and conditions.
Are pets allowed at Royal Hotel?
Sorry, pets aren't allowed, but service animals are welcome.
Is parking offered on site at Royal Hotel?
Yes, there's free self parking.
What are the check-in and check-out times at Royal Hotel?
Check-in start time: 3:00 PM; check-in end time: 9:00 PM. Check-out time is 11 AM. Late check-out is available for a charge. Express check-out is available.
What is there to do at Royal Hotel and nearby?
Have fun with activities such as boat tours, hiking and mountain biking, and practise your swing at the nearby golf course. Additional recreation on-site includes bowling.
Are there restaurants at or near Royal Hotel?
Yes, Tokyo Japanese Grill offers Japanese cuisine.
What's the area around Royal Hotel like?
Royal Hotel is in Chilliwack Proper, a short 12-minute walk from Chilliwack Cultural Centre and 4 minutes' walk from Chilliwack Museum and Historical Society.
